Always felt like this was going to be one of the more lackluster decks of this set. Morph is just not that interesting and is poorly supported despite having an entire block, for some reason, dedicated to it and its sister mechanics. The most interesting take on the mechanic (manifest) was completely wasted by not letting you flip over and cast the manifested instants and sorceries. Megamorph was not only the name of a Yugioh card, but literally the dumbest and least interesting direction to go with the mechanic. Individually, morph doesn't work well with a regular playgroup outside of a few specific cards simply because Willbender stops being a good trick after everyone knows you only run the one morph card. They did a pretty piss poor job of making people want to run morph and the much requested morph deck didn't fix the issues for those that did. The crap reprints don't help either.

So the manabase is better than last years, but I never understand why they keep giving us crap like Thornwood Falls. There’s so much with a conditional untap for cheap, even just 2-3 more would mean the world.
It's not hard to figure out. Thornwood Falls adds essentially 0 to the deck's value, allowing them to allot that elsewhere, whereas any of the rare conditionally untapped lands add some. My argument would not be to add rare lands, but instead to design more common/uncommon level lands that aren't meant to be valuable. They are never going to run out of places to reprint lands like that.
